Fountain Sultan Ahmed III
The first-of-its-kind, Sultan Ahmed Fountain in front of Topkapi Palace is an elegant monument in itself. Surrounded by Topkapi Palace and Hagia Sophia, this Fountain rarely gets the attention that it deserves. We will examine its Tulip Period ornaments with a special attention and understand its impact to the city.

Citerne Basilique
Yerebatan (Basilica) Cistern is a 6th-century Roman water structure and the largest of its kind in Istanbul. With endless rows of columns, its has a unique appearance. It is considered as a top sight in Istanbul. There may be a 30-minute waiting time on busy days.

Mosquée bleue
This 17th-century masterpiece of Ottoman architecture is one of the top sights in Istanbul. Its interior provides one of the most glamorous examples of Ottoman mosques. It is decorated with thousands of tiles and extensive penwork. Starting from its outer courtyard to the inner corners, this mosque provides several elegant examples of the Turkish artistic taste of the 17th century.

Place Sultanahmet
Sultanahmet Square is the ancient Roman Hippodrome and contains some of Istanbul's oldest and most important sights. The Egyptian Obelisk, Serpent Column, Masonary Obelisk and German Fountain are among those sights. Each of them has its own fascinating stories and not-easy-to-notice aspects, which I will happily share during our visit.

Mosquée Sainte-Sophie
The Hagia Sophia Mosque in Istanbul is one of the masterpieces of world architecture and a UNESCO World Heritage Site. This 6th-century building contains artistic items and architectural features from the Roman, Byzantine and Ottoman civilizations. It is a must-see in Istanbul, but for that reason, there are long queues which may result with 1-2 hours of waiting time. Grand Bazar
As a key city of the Silk Road and the Spice Road, Istanbul boasts the presence of some of the best medieval bazaars in the world. The Grand Bazaar and the Egyptian (Spice) Bazaar are still some of most lively commercial buildings in Istanbul. Depending on the personal preference of my guests, we can visit one or both of them. Grand Bazaar is closed on sunday.

Beyazit Mosque
Although Blue Mosque is the most visited Ottoman mosque in Istanbul because of its location at the heart of Old City, several other mosques are worth visiting because of their historical significance and architectural aspects. Beyazit Mosque in particular contains very interesting features that are unique in Istanbul. We will take a look at its colorful decoration dated 1505.
